A marine cartilaginous fish that can produce electric current is:

Options

(a) Pristis
(b) Torpedo
(c) Trygon
(d) Scoliodon

Correct Answer:

Torpedo

Explanation:

Torpedo is a sluggish fish. It is carnivorous. The prey is first killed by electric shock. The shock can also be harmful for human beings.
